ELKINS – This morning’s severe rain and wind storm has knocked out electricity for thousands of homes in multiple local counties.
In Randolph County, 1,735 residences were without power as of 9:25 a.m., according to First Energy.
A total of 295 homes without electricity were reported in Mill Creek, with 276 reported in Beverly, 268 in Coalton, 255 in Mabie, 164 in Elkins, 140 in Whitmer, 104 in Harman and 73 in Valley Bend.
In Upshur County, 1,440 homes were without power, officials said.
